Core Viewpoint - AI chipmaker Cerebrris has decided to withdraw its IPO plans, citing regulatory scrutiny and concerns over its dependence on a single customer [1] Group 1: IPO Withdrawal - Cerebrris filed for its IPO in September but has now opted not to proceed with the deal at this time [1] - The decision to pull the IPO comes amid challenges including regulatory scrutiny [1] Group 2: Funding and Valuation - Recently, Cerebrris raised over $1 billion in private funding, achieving an $8 billion valuation [2] - This funding provides the company with additional time to remain private [2]
